Getaround Inc., the car-sharing platform, has combined its European business, Getaround Europe, with GoMore, a leading Danish car-sharing company.
Following completion of the transaction, GoMore now operates across 11 countries, forming a unique car-sharing and ride-sharing network in Europe.
Orrick advised Getaround.
Getaround Europe, headquartered in Paris, is the market leader in France and firmly established across Western Europe, including Germany, Belgium, Spain, Norway and Austria, building on the legacy of Drivy and Nabobil, both acquired in 2019.
GoMore, headquartered in Copenhagen, is the market leader in the Nordics - Denmark, Sweden, Finland and Estonia - and also operates in Spain under the Amovens brand, as well as in Switzerland and Austria.
This transaction marks a significant step in the consolidation of the European car-sharing market, creating a leading platform with the scale, technology and operational capabilities to accelerate growth across borders.
